Signs of Renal Failure in Dogs One of the … WebGlomerular proteinuria should be reduced in dogs and cats with CKD stages 1 through 4. Intervention is indicated when the urine protein-to-creatinine ratio (UPC) exceeds 2.0 in dogs and cats with CKD stage 1, and when the UPC exceeds 0.5 in dogs and 0.4 in cats with CKD stages 2 through 4. WebJan 24, 2024 · Stage 2. Chronic kidney disease occurs when the blood creatinine is between 1.4-2.8mg/dl, and the SDMA level is 18-35mg/dl. These dogs may leak protein into their urine and experience slightly high blood pressure. Dogs with stage 2 disease have mild failure and don’t typically show clinical signs.
